Output 2abac2ede92504478558c05283031476056ea1f44ca60251470eb174fffe9ddb:0

value
20600
script pubkey
OP_0 OP_PUSHBYTES_20 a1bdc86389c6cd463a7c710500fb614b58fc9818
address
bc1q5x7uscufcmx5vwnuwyzsp7mpfdv0exqcjm7ne4
transaction
2abac2ede92504478558c05283031476056ea1f44ca60251470eb174fffe9ddb
confirmations
145151
spent
true